求助
查看原帖
求助
341363
Zelin990楼主2022/2/11 18:00

求助,样例全过

#include<bits/stdc++.h>
using namespace std;
string str;
char f[1919810];
int ans;
bool flag=0;
int main(){
	int n;
	cin>>n;
	for(int i=0;i<=n-1;i++){
		cin>>str;
		f[i]=str[0];
	}
	for(int i=0;i<n;i++){
		if(f[i]=='A'){
			flag=1;
			break;
		}
	}
	if(flag==0){
		cout<<0;
		return 0;
	}
	for(int i=0;i<=n-1;i++){
		if(f[i]=='A'){
			for(int j=i;j<n;j++){
				if(f[j+1]-'0'==f[j]-'0'+1)ans++;
				else break;
			}	
		} 
		else continue;
	}
	cout<<ans+1;
	return 0;
}
2022/2/11 18:00
加载中...